Abstract

An autopsy case performed by the author in 1986 had been gradually revealed to be a murder using aconite poisons. The puffer fish toxin was certified afterwards to be co-administered together with aconite alkaloids in this case. In order to investigate this murder case, animal experiments were done using mice to clarify the metabolism of aconitine and tetrodotoxin, and to examine the influences of tetrodotoxin on aconite poisoning. We also examined biological effects under the chronic intoxication of aconitine, and the elimination and degradation of aconitine in dead body. For this purpose we have developed technical methods using GC/MS and LC/MS for the quantification of these toxins in biological materials.
